Recreational XC Hardtail INTELLIGENT DESIGN A star in our line-up for more than two decades, the Rockhopper® with its ultra-refined M4® alloy frame has evolved into the smart choice for anything from a flowing fire road to a fast singletrack.Inside Tech For 2008, we've made both our legendary Stumpjumper and Rockhopper models in a 29-inch wheeled version, with some important improvements over similar bikes on the market. Our unique geometry allows Specialized 29er mountain bikes to have a lower center of gravity and more stability than others of the breed, making for a nimble, yet stable ride. When combined with our new The CaptainTM tire in a 29-inch version, there's no better 29er to handle a wide range of conditions.

FRAME
M4 manipulated alloy frame, butted ORE DT, forged dropouts w/ replaceable 98954020 alloy hanger, disc only
HEADSET
1 1/8"" threadless
SEAT BINDER
Specialized alloy w/ QR, brass washer
FORK
RockShox Tora 302 SL, 100mm, 32mm Cr-Mo stanchions and alloy steerer, Mag lower, coil spring, preload adj., LO w/ reb. adj.
FRONT TIRE
Specialized Fast Trak LK Sport, 26x2.0"", 60TPI, wire bead
REAR TIRE
Specialized Fast Trak LK Sport, 26x2.0"", 60TPI, wire bead
RIMS
Specialized/Alex RHD 26, double wall, eyelets, for disc brakes
FRONT HUB
Specialized Hi Lo disc, 28h, CNC flange and disc mount, polished races, alloy QR
REAR HUB
Specialized Hi Lo disc, cassette, 32h, CNC flanges and disc mount, polished races, alloy QR
SPOKES
1.8mm (15g) stainless, alloy nipples, black
FRONT DERAILLEUR
Shimano Deore FD-M530, 34.9mm clamp
REAR DERAILLEUR
Shimano LX RD-M581, SGS cage
SHIFT LEVERS
Shimano Deore SL-M530 trigger
CHAIN
KMC X9, 1/2"" x 3/32"" w/ reusable Missing Link
CRANKSET
Shimano FC-M442-8, replaceable rings w/ alloy outer, Octalink Spline
CHAINRINGS
44A/32S/22S
BOTTOM BRACKET
Shimano BB-ES25, Octalink spline, cartridge bearing, 68 x 118mm for 50mm chainline
STEM
Specialized 3D forged alloy w/ graphic, four bolt clamp, 7 degree rise
HANDLEBARS
Specialized alloy butted 31.8mm XC rise w/ graphic, 640mm wide, 8 degree back, 8 degree up sweep
SADDLE
Specialized Indie XC, 143mm width
FRONT BRAKE
Avid Juicy 3 SL, hydraulic, 6"" G2 clean sweep rotor
REAR BRAKE
Avid Juicy 3 SL, hydraulic, 6"" G2 Clean Sweep rotor
BRAKE LEVERS
Avid Juicy 3 SL, hydraulic
PEDALS
Specialized alloy 1pc body and cage, 9/16""

13 | 15 | 17 | 19 | 21 | 23 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Bottom Bracket Height - Low Setting | 304mm | 304mm | 304mm | 304mm | 304mm | 304mm |
Top Tube Length (Horizontal) | 545mm | 565mm | 590mm | 615mm | 640mm | 660mm |
Head Tube Height | 100mm | 100mm | 110mm | 120mm | 140mm | 160mm |
Head Tube Angle - Low Setting | 70° | 70° | 70° | 70° | 70° | 70° |
Seat Tube Angle (Actual) - Low Setting | 73° | 73° | 73° | 73° | 73° | 73° |
Top Tube Length (Actual) | 546mm | 551mm | 568mm | 590mm | 615mm | 638mm |
Seat Tube Length - Center to Top | 330mm | 381mm | 432mm | 483mm | 533mm | 584mm |
Wheel Base | 1030mm | 1050mm | 1075mm | 1101mm | 1127mm | 1148mm |
Standover Height | 681mm | 715mm | 750mm | 783mm | 820mm | 855mm |
Chainstay Length | 426mm | 426mm | 426mm | 426mm | 426mm | 426mm |
Crank Length | 170mm | 170mm | 175mm | 175mm | 175mm | 175mm |
Handlebar Width | 640mm | 640mm | 640mm | 640mm | 640mm | 640mm |
Stem Length | 60mm | 75mm | 75mm | 90mm | 90mm | 90mm |
Seatpost Length | 350mm | 350mm | 350mm | 400mm | 400mm | 400mm |
